POLYMERIZATION OF ACRYLAMIDE BY USING INITIATION SYSTEM CONSISTING OF N-METHACRYLOYL -N'- PYRIMIDINOPIPERAZINE AND PERSULFATE
GAO Qing-yu,ZHANG Fu-lian,YANG Geng-xu,ZHANG Jn-xian,LI Fu-mian.POLYMERIZATION OF ACRYLAMIDE BY USING INITIATION SYSTEM CONSISTING OF N-METHACRYLOYL -N''- PYRIMIDINOPIPERAZINE AND PERSULFATE[J].Acta Polymerica Sinica,1994,0(3):369-373.
Authors:GAO Qing-yu  ZHANG Fu-lian  YANG Geng-xu  ZHANG Jn-xian  LI Fu-mian
Institution:Department of Chemistry and Chemical Engineering; Henan University; Kaifen; 475001; Department of Chemistry; Peking University; Beijing; 100871
Abstract:queous solution polymerization of acrylamide (AAm) was demonstrated by using initiation system consisting of N-methacryloyl-N '-pyrimidinopiperazine (MPMP ) and persulfate (KPS). The polymerization rate equation was obtained to beRp = KpMPMP]1/2 KPS]1/2 AAm]1.0The overall activation energy for the polymerization was calculated by Arrhenius quation to be Ea= 5.6 KJ/mol. The redox nature for the polymerization was clarified. A super high molecular weight up to 107 of PAAm was obtained by using this initiation system. From the fluorescent analysis, it was confirmed that MPMP not only acted as a component of the redox system, but also entered into the acrylamide polymer chains.
